Savor the flavor of cheese-stuffed squid in this Sci-Fi Channel bid for the title of silliest B-movie in recent memory! Kraken: Tentacles of the Deep (2006) is the story of poor, orphaned Charlie O'Connell and his Ahab-lite plight. Thanks to a huge CGI squid, he grew up a very lonely kid, and now that he's grown, he's looking for deep-fried vengeance to call his own. Into his psychic lair of calamaried misery comes Victoria Pratt, a beautiful marine archaeologist looking for booty . . . of the sunken-treasure kind. The same tentacled ghoul that took Charlie's parents is guarding the wreckage Vicki wants to poke around in, so Charlie, seizing the opportunity, heads out to sea with the dishy Vicki and a desire to see revenge served best: in its own ink. Jack Scalia stops by to play a treasure-bent scumbag, and hot Kristi Angus drops in, top round steaks bouncing in a bikini top, to add some turf to the surf.
